repo.or.cz
/
linux-2.6
/
libata-dev.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Merge remote branch 'korg/drm-radeon-next' of into drm-linus
2009-12-10
Thomas Hellstr
o
m
drm/
r
ade
o
n
: Re
m
o
v
e tests for
-ERESTART from t
h
e
TTM
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-10
T
homas Hel
l
s
t
ro
m
dr
m
/ttm: Have the TTM
code return -EREST
A
R
TSYS in
s
tead
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-07
Tho
m
as Hellstrom
d
r
m
: Ex
p
ort symbol
s
n
e
e
ded for th
e
vmwgfx driv
e
r
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-07
Thomas Hellstrom
drm/ttm
:
E
x
port symbols n
e
ed
e
d for
t
he vmwgfx driv
e
r
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-07
Thoma
s
Hellstro
m
d
r
m
/ttm:
Add TTM exec
b
uf uti
l
ities
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-07
Thomas Hellstrom
d
rm/ttm: Add ttm lock func
t
ionality
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-07
Thomas
Hells
t
rom
drm
/
t
t
m:
Add
user-space o
b
jects
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-12-03
Thomas Hellstrom
drm: Add support
f
or
d
rm mas
t
er_[set|drop] ca
l
l
backs
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-21
Thomas Hel
l
strom
drm: Fix s
y
sfs dev
i
ce co
n
fusio
n
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-20
Thomas Hellstrom
drm/t
t
m
:
F
i
xes fo
r
"
Memory
a
c
c
o
unti
n
g rework
.
"
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-20
T
h
omas H
e
llstrom
drm
/
tt
m
: Fi
x
es f
o
r "Make parts
o
f a struct ttm_bo_device
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-19
Thomas Hellstro
m
ttm:
Make pa
r
ts of a struct tt
m
_
bo_device global
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-19
Tho
m
as Hellstrom
drm/tt
m
:
Memory accounting re
w
o
rk
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-19
T
h
omas Hellstro
m
dr
m
/
t
t
m: Add a virtual ttm sysf
s
device
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-19
Thomas Hellstrom
drm
:
Enable drm dri
v
ers to add drm
s
ysfs devices
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-04
T
h
omas Hell
s
trom
dr
m
/ttm: Fix a
sync object leak
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-04
Th
o
m
as Hell
s
trom
drm/ttm: Fix
a
p
otential com
p
a
ri
s
on
of structs
.
Original partial fix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-08-03
Thomas H
e
llstrom
x
8
6:
F
i
x
C
P
A memtype reserving in the set_pages_array
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-29
Tho
m
as Hellstrom
drm/tt
m
: powerpc: Fix H
i
g
hmem cach
e
flushing
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-29
T
h
omas
H
ellstrom
x86: Export km
a
p
_
a
to
m
ic_prot() ne
e
ded for TTM
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-29
Th
o
mas
Hells
t
r
o
m
drm/ttm: Fix ttm
i
n-kernel copying of pages with
n
on
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-29
Thomas Hellstrom
d
r
m
/
ttm: Fix
an oops and sync ob
j
ect leak
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-15
T
h
omas
H
ellst
r
om
t
tm: Fi
x
cach
i
ng mode selecti
o
n
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-07-15
T
h
omas Hellst
r
om
ttm: Make mes
s
ages
m
ore readable
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-06-18
Thomas Hellst
r
om
drm/ttm
:
fix an
e
r
ror path to exit f
u
n
ction correctly
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-06-18
Thomas H
e
llst
r
om
drm: Apply "M
e
mory fragmentatio
n
from
l
o
s
t
a
li
g
nment
.
.
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-06-18
Thom
a
s Hellstrom
ttm: Return -ER
E
ST
A
RT when a signal interrupts bo evi
c
t
i
on
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-06-14
Thomas Hell
s
trom
d
r
m
: Add th
e
TTM G
P
U
memory manager subsyst
e
m
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-03-02
Thomas He
l
lstrom
drm: Avoid c
l
ient d
e
adlocks when
the master disappears
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-03-02
Thomas Hellstrom
drm: Wake up all lo
c
k waiters w
h
e
n the ma
s
t
e
r disappears
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2009-03-02
Thomas Hellstrom
drm: Don't ret
u
r
n
ERESTARTSYS t
o
user
-
space
.
Signed-off-by:
Thomas Hellstrom
<thellstrom@vmware.com>
commit
|
commitdiff
|
tree
2008-10-16
T
h
oma
s
Hellstro
m
agp/nvidia: Support a
g
p user
-
memo
r
y
on nvidia
agp
.
commit
|
commitdiff
|
tree
2008-08-24
T
homas Hell
s
trom
drm
:
don'
t
call the
v
b
l
ank taskle
t
with irqs dis
a
bled
.
commit
|
commitdiff
|
tree
2008-05-07
Thomas Hells
t
rom
drm: d
i
sab
l
e t
a
sklets not
I
RQs w
h
e
n taking t
h
e
drm
.
.
.
commit
|
commitdiff
|
tree
2008-03-17
Thomas Hel
l
strom
drm/via
:
a
t
t
empt again to s
t
abilise the AGP
D
M
A command
.
.
.
commit
|
commitdiff
|
tree
2007-05-08
Th
o
mas H
e
llstr
o
m
via
:
Make sure we flu
s
h write-combin
i
ng
u
sing a follow
.
.
.
commit
|
commitdiff
|
tree
2007-05-08
Thomas Hellstrom
v
ia: Try to improve command-buffer chai
n
ing
.
commit
|
commitdiff
|
tree
2007-03-24
Thomas Hellstrom
d
r
m:
f
ix up mmap loc
k
ing in pre
p
aration for t
t
m changes
commit
|
commitdiff
|
tree
2007-03-23
Thoma
s
H
ellstrom
drm: fix dri
v
e
r deadloc
k
wit
h
AIGLX and reclaim_buffer
s
_locked
commit
|
commitdiff
|
tree
2007-03-18
Thoma
s
Hellstrom
drm: allow for more generic drm ioc
t
ls
commit
|
commitdiff
|
tree
2007-03-11
Thomas Hel
l
strom
vi
a
: fix CX700 pci id
commit
|
commitdiff
|
tree
2007-02-08
T
h
omas Hellstrom
drm:
A
ll
o
w for 44 bit user
-
tokens (or drm_file offsets)
commit
|
commitdiff
|
tree
2007-02-08
Thoma
s
Hellstrom
drm/via
:
D
i
sable AGP DMA
for chi
p
s w
i
th the
new 3D
.
.
.
commit
|
commitdiff
|
tree
2007-02-08
Thomas Hellstrom
drm:
u
p
d
a
te c
o
re
memory manager from
git
d
rm tree
commit
|
commitdiff
|
tree
2007-02-08
Th
o
mas Hellstrom
drm: use vma
l
loc
_
u
s
e
r
instead
of vmalloc
_
32
f
or D
R
M_SHM
commit
|
commitdiff
|
tree
2007-02-08
Thomas He
l
lstrom
via:
all
o
w for npot textur
e
pitch alignment
commit
|
commitdiff
|
tree
2007-02-08
Thomas Hellstrom
via: add some new chip
s
ets
commit
|
commitdiff
|
tree
2007-02-08
Thomas He
l
lstrom
v
i
a: some PCI
p
osting
f
lushe
s
commit
|
commitdiff
|
tree
2007-02-05
Thoma
s
Hellstrom
[AGPGART] Add agp-type-to-mask-type method missi
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-02-03
Thom
a
s
Hellstrom
[
AGPGART] Al
l
ow drm
-
pop
u
l
a
t
e
d agp memory types
Signed-off-by:
Thomas Hellstrom
<thomas@tungstengraphics.com>
commit
|
commitdiff
|
tree
2006-12-29
Thomas Hellstrom
[AGPGART] Fix
PCI-po
s
t
ing fl
u
sh ty
p
o
.
Signed-off-by:
Thomas Hellstrom
<thomas@tungstengraphics.com>
commit
|
commitdiff
|
tree
2006-12-23
Thoma
s
H
ellstrom
[AGPGART] Re
m
ove unne
c
essary f
l
ushes w
h
en inserting
.
.
.
Signed-off-by:
Thomas Hellstrom
<thomas@tungstengraphics.com>
commit
|
commitdiff
|
tree
2006-09-21
T
h
o
mas Hellstrom
drm: allow
m
ul
t
ip
l
e addMaps w
i
t
h
the sa
m
e
32-bit map
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Tho
m
as Hellstrom
drm:
Fix hashtab
i
m
plement
a
tion leaking ill
e
ga
l
error
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Thomas Hellstrom
drm
:
remove hash tables on drm exit
commit
|
commitdiff
|
tree
2006-09-21
T
homas Hell
s
t
r
o
m
drm
:
avoid kernel oops
i
n
some error paths calling
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
T
h
o
mas Hellstrom
drm:
S
iS 315 Awa
r
enes
s
.
commit
|
commitdiff
|
tree
2006-09-21
Thoma
s
H
e
l
lstrom
drm: update user token
h
a
shing and m
a
p
h
andles
commit
|
commitdiff
|
tree
2006-09-21
Thomas Hellstrom
drm: move drm auth
e
n
t
ica
t
io
n
to new ge
n
e
r
ic hash table
.
commit
|
commitdiff
|
tree
2006-09-21
Thomas Hellstr
o
m
drm:
add drm s
i
mple memory
manage
r
suppo
r
t for SiS
.
.
.
commit
|
commitdiff
|
tree
2006-09-21
Thomas Hells
t
rom
drm: add
simple DRM
m
emor
y
manager, and ha
s
h tabl
e
commit
|
commitdiff
|
tree
2006-09-21
Tho
m
as
Hellstro
m
drm:
m
issing mu
t
ex
u
nl
o
c
k
commit
|
commitdiff
|
tree